On February 25, 2025, Natural Dior LLC initiated a voluntary nationwide recall of its dietary supplement, Vitafer-L Gold Liquid, after discovering the presence of undeclared tadalafil—a phosphodiesterase (PDE-5) inhibitor used to treat erectile dysfunction. Tadalafil can interact with nitrates found in some prescription medications, potentially causing a significant and life-threatening drop in blood pressure. The recall affects multiple lot numbers with expiration dates ranging from March 2025 to April 2026. The product is packaged in 16.9 fl oz (500 mL) bottles within folding cardboard boxes. To date, no adverse events related to this recall have been reported. Consumers are advised to stop using the product immediately and consult their healthcare provider if they experience any adverse reactions.
